:root{--container: 1200px}body{font-family:var(--font-primary--family);color:var(--color-foreground);-webkit-font-smoothing:antialiased}.container{width:100%;max-width:var(--container);margin-inline:auto;padding-inline:20px}.adv-eyebrow{font-size:.78rem;letter-spacing:.18em;text-transform:uppercase;color:var(--color-brand);font-weight:700;margin:0 0 .5rem}.adv-h2{font-family:var(--font-heading--family);font-size:clamp(1.6rem,3vw,2.4rem);line-height:1.15;font-weight:var(--font-heading--weight, 700);text-transform:uppercase;letter-spacing:.01em;color:var(--color-heading);margin:0}.adv-h3{font-family:var(--font-heading--family);font-size:1.1rem;font-weight:var(--font-heading--weight, 700);color:var(--color-heading);margin:0 0 .35rem}.adv-section{padding-block:clamp(2.5rem,6vw,4.5rem)}.adv-section--tight{padding-block:clamp(1.5rem,4vw,2.5rem)}.adv-center{text-align:center}.adv-btn{display:inline-flex;align-items:center;gap:.5rem;font-size:.8r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ase;text-decoration:none;padding:.7rem 1.4rem;border-radius:2px;border:0;cursor:pointer;transition:background-color .18s ease,color .18s ease}.adv-btn--primary{background:var(--color-brand);color:#fff}.adv-btn--primary:hover{background:var(--color-brand-dark)}.adv-btn--ghost{background:transparent;color:var(--color-brand);border:1px solid var(--color-brand)}.adv-btn--ghost:hover{background:var(--color-brand);color:#fff}.adv-btn .adv-arrow{font-size:.9em;line-height:1}a{color:inherit}.adv-grid{display:grid;gap:1.5rem}@media(min-width:768px){.adv-grid--3{grid-template-columns:repeat(3,1fr)}}.adv-product{background:#fff;border:1px solid var(--color-border);border-radius:4px;padding:1.25rem;text-align:center;text-decoration:none;color:inherit;display:flex;flex-direction:column;align-items:center;gap:.5rem;transition:box-shadow .18s ease,transform .18s ease}.adv-product:hover{box-shadow:0 10px 24px #00000014;transform:translateY(-3px)}.adv-product__link{text-decoration:none;color:inherit;display:flex;flex-direction:column;align-items:center;gap:.5rem;width:100%}.adv-product__form{margin:0;width:100%}.adv-product__form .adv-product__btn{width:100%;justify-content:center;cursor:pointer}.adv-product__img{width:100%;aspect-ratio:1 / 1;display:flex;align-items:center;justify-content:center}.adv-product__img img{max-height:100%;width:auto}.adv-product__title{font-size:.98rem;font-weight:700;color:var(--color-heading);margin:.25rem 0 0}.adv-product__price{color:var(--color-brand);font-weight:700}.adv-product__btn{margin-top:.5rem}.adv-paylater{max-width:420px;width:100%}.adv-paylater__msg{min-height:40px;margin-bottom:12px}.adv-paylater__btn{min-height:48px}.adv-paylater__status{display:none;margin-top:12px;padding:10px;border-radius:4px;font-size:13px;text-align:center;font-weight:500}.adv-product__form,.adv-product .adv-paylater,.adv-product>a.adv-product__btn{margin-top:auto;width:100%}.adv-product__btn{width:100%;min-height:48px;display:inline-flex;align-items:center;justify-content:center}.adv-product .adv-paylater__btn{min-height:48px}.rte{overflow-wrap:anywhere}.rte img{max-width:100%;height:auto}.adv-ptabs__pane table{display:block;width:100%;overflow-x:auto;-webkit-overflow-scrolling:touch}@media(max-width:600px){.adv-ptabs__pane table{font-size:.85rem}.adv-ptabs__nav{gap:0}.adv-ptabs__tab{padding:.7rem .9rem;font-size:.78rem}}.adv-cfg{display:flex;flex-direction:column;gap:.9rem;margin-top:.5rem}.adv-cfg__field{display:flex;flex-direction:column;gap:.35rem}.adv-cfg__label{font-size:.85rem;font-weight:600;color:var(--color-heading)}.adv-cfg__req{color:var(--color-brand)}.adv-cfg__select,.adv-cfg__input{width:100%;padding:.6rem .7rem;border:1px solid var(--color-border);border-radius:4px;background:#fff}.adv-cfg__acctitle{font-size:.85rem;font-weight:700;color:var(--color-heading);margin-bottom:.4rem;text-transform:uppercase;letter-spacing:.03em}.adv-cfg__acclist{display:flex;flex-direction:column;gap:.45rem;border:1px solid var(--color-border);border-radius:4px;padding:.75rem;max-height:260px;overflow-y:auto}.adv-cfg__acc{display:grid;grid-template-columns:auto 1fr auto;align-items:center;gap:.6rem;font-size:.92rem;cursor:pointer}.adv-cfg__acc-price{color:var(--color-brand);font-weight:600;font-size:.88rem}.adv-cfg__total{display:flex;justify-content:space-between;align-items:baseline;border-top:1px solid var(--color-border);padding-top:.9rem;margin-top:.3rem;font-weight:700;color:var(--color-heading)}.adv-cfg__total-val{font-size:1.5rem;color:var(--color-brand)}.adv-cfg__add{width:100%;justify-content:center;cursor:pointer}.adv-cfg__err{color:var(--color-brand);font-size:.85rem;margin:0}
/*# sourceMappingURL=/cdn/shop/t/3/assets/brand.css.map */
